Subject: [PATCH v2 03/13] KVM: x86: pass the whole hflags field to emulator and back
Date: Wed, 27 May 2015 19:05:04 +0200	[thread overview]
Message-ID: <1432746314-50196-4-git-send-email-pbonzini@redhat.com> (raw)
In-Reply-To: <1432746314-50196-1-git-send-email-pbonzini@redhat.com>

The hflags field will contain information about system management mode
and will be useful for the emulator.  Pass the entire field rather than
just the guest-mode information.

 arch/x86/include/asm/kvm_emulate.h |  5 ++++-
 arch/x86/kvm/emulate.c             |  6 +++---
 arch/x86/kvm/x86.c                 | 10 +++++++++-
 3 files changed, 16 insertions(+), 5 deletions(-)

diff --git a/arch/x86/include/asm/kvm_emulate.h b/arch/x86/include/asm/kvm_emulate.h
index 57a9d94fe160..7410879a41f7 100644
--- a/arch/x86/include/asm/kvm_emulate.h
+++ b/arch/x86/include/asm/kvm_emulate.h
@@ -262,6 +262,9 @@ enum x86emul_mode {
 	X86EMUL_MODE_PROT64,	/* 64-bit (long) mode.    */
 };
 
+/* These match some of the HF_* flags defined in kvm_host.h  */
+#define X86EMUL_GUEST_MASK           (1 << 5) /* VCPU is in guest-mode */
+
 struct x86_emulate_ctxt {
 	const struct x86_emulate_ops *ops;
 
@@ -273,8 +276,8 @@ struct x86_emulate_ctxt {
 
 	/* interruptibility state, as a result of execution of STI or MOV SS */
 	int interruptibility;
+	int emul_flags;
 
-	bool guest_mode; /* guest running a nested guest */
 	bool perm_ok; /* do not check permissions if true */
 	bool ud;	/* inject an #UD if host doesn't support insn */
 
diff --git a/arch/x86/kvm/emulate.c b/arch/x86/kvm/emulate.c
index 9b655d113fc6..a1c6c25552e9 100644
--- a/arch/x86/kvm/emulate.c
+++ b/arch/x86/kvm/emulate.c
@@ -4895,7 +4895,7 @@ int x86_emulate_insn(struct x86_emulate_ctxt *ctxt)
 				fetch_possible_mmx_operand(ctxt, &ctxt->dst);
 		}
 
-		if (unlikely(ctxt->guest_mode) && (ctxt->d & Intercept)) {
+		if (unlikely(ctxt->emul_flags & X86EMUL_GUEST_MASK) && ctxt->intercept) {
 			rc = emulator_check_intercept(ctxt, ctxt->intercept,
 						      X86_ICPT_PRE_EXCEPT);
 			if (rc != X86EMUL_CONTINUE)
@@ -4924,7 +4924,7 @@ int x86_emulate_insn(struct x86_emulate_ctxt *ctxt)
 				goto done;
 		}
 
-		if (unlikely(ctxt->guest_mode) && (ctxt->d & Intercept)) {
+		if (unlikely(ctxt->emul_flags & X86EMUL_GUEST_MASK) && (ctxt->d & Intercept)) {
 			rc = emulator_check_intercept(ctxt, ctxt->intercept,
 						      X86_ICPT_POST_EXCEPT);
 			if (rc != X86EMUL_CONTINUE)
@@ -4978,7 +4978,7 @@ int x86_emulate_insn(struct x86_emulate_ctxt *ctxt)
 
 special_insn:
 
-	if (unlikely(ctxt->guest_mode) && (ctxt->d & Intercept)) {
+	if (unlikely(ctxt->emul_flags & X86EMUL_GUEST_MASK) && (ctxt->d & Intercept)) {
 		rc = emulator_check_intercept(ctxt, ctxt->intercept,
 					      X86_ICPT_POST_MEMACCESS);
 		if (rc != X86EMUL_CONTINUE)
diff --git a/arch/x86/kvm/x86.c b/arch/x86/kvm/x86.c
index 747bf7da550b..70072f94318e 100644
--- a/arch/x86/kvm/x86.c
+++ b/arch/x86/kvm/x86.c
@@ -5236,7 +5236,8 @@ static void init_emulate_ctxt(struct kvm_vcpu *vcpu)
 		     (cs_l && is_long_mode(vcpu))	? X86EMUL_MODE_PROT64 :
 		     cs_db				? X86EMUL_MODE_PROT32 :
 							  X86EMUL_MODE_PROT16;
-	ctxt->guest_mode = is_guest_mode(vcpu);
+	BUILD_BUG_ON(HF_GUEST_MASK != X86EMUL_GUEST_MASK);
+	ctxt->emul_flags = vcpu->arch.hflags;
 
 	init_decode_cache(ctxt);
 	vcpu->arch.emulate_regs_need_sync_from_vcpu = false;
@@ -5405,6 +5406,11 @@ static bool retry_instruction(struct x86_emulate_ctxt *ctxt,
 static int complete_emulated_mmio(struct kvm_vcpu *vcpu);
 static int complete_emulated_pio(struct kvm_vcpu *vcpu);
 
+void kvm_set_hflags(struct kvm_vcpu *vcpu, unsigned emul_flags)
+{
+	vcpu->arch.hflags = emul_flags;
+}
+
 static int kvm_vcpu_check_hw_bp(unsigned long addr, u32 type, u32 dr7,
 				unsigned long *db)
 {
@@ -5604,6 +5610,8 @@ restart:
 		unsigned long rflags = kvm_x86_ops->get_rflags(vcpu);
 		toggle_interruptibility(vcpu, ctxt->interruptibility);
 		vcpu->arch.emulate_regs_need_sync_to_vcpu = false;
+		if (vcpu->arch.hflags != ctxt->emul_flags)
+			kvm_set_hflags(vcpu, ctxt->emul_flags);
 		kvm_rip_write(vcpu, ctxt->eip);
 		if (r == EMULATE_DONE)
 			kvm_vcpu_check_singlestep(vcpu, rflags, &r);
